Who is Megan Abbott?

Prepare to be enchanted by the extraordinary talent of Megan Abbott, a luminary in the world of crime fiction and psychological thrillers. Born in the electrifying setting of Detroit in the early 1970s, Abbott has emerged as one of the most captivating voices in contemporary literature. With her distinctive style that melds the elements of noir with an incisive exploration of the human psyche, Megan Abbott has enthralled readers globally. Her works are not just stories; they are compelling narratives that venture into the oft-unexplored recesses of human emotions and societal complexities.

The Writing Odyssey

Megan Abbott's journey into the literary world is a fascinating saga of relentless curiosity and intellectual vigor. After obtaining her PhD in English and American literature from New York University, she did not simply rest within the theoretical confines of academia. Instead, she launched herself headlong into fiction, beginning with her breakout work, Die a Little (2005). Her subsequent novels have continued to expand and refine her exploration of ambition, femininity, and power.

Abbott’s writing is frequently defined by its meticulously crafted plots and an atmosphere thick with tension. She possesses a knack for weaving narratives that not only entertain but also provoke introspection about societal norms and personal vulnerabilities. Her books, such as The Fever (2014) and You Will Know Me (2016), encapsulate an exquisite balance between thrilling suspense and profound insight into the human condition.

Plotting with Precision

Megan Abbott’s narratives are nothing short of architectural marvels – each story impeccably structured to maintain an irresistible grip on her audience. Her talent for creating suspense is evident in how she constructs her plotlines, often intertwining multiple story arcs that converge in climactic revelations.

In novels like The End of Everything (2011) and Give Me Your Hand (2018), Abbott's mastery of suspense and pace is plain to see.
